Coral Products PLC (AIM:CRU) jumped 18% as the plastic container maker announced the sale and leaseback of two freehold properties on the Haydock Industrial Estate, Haydock, and booked a further £900,000 from an insurance settlement.
The properties are being sold to Glenbrook H1 for £1.7 million against a book value of £1.3 million with the buildings to be leased for 15 years at an initial rate of £155,000 per annum.
In addition, Coral said settlement has been reached for an insurance claim made by subsidiary Film & Foil Solutions relating to a fire in May 2020, resulting in a cash payment of £900,000 to the company.
In total, the gross cash proceeds from the developments will be £2.6 million with£1.1 million earmarked to pay down, in full, the remainder of the mortgage on the two freehold properties and other borrowings.
The remaining £1.5 million will be used to strengthen both working capital and the balance sheet.
Joe Grimmond, Coral Products chairman, added: “Together with the cost efficiencies we continue to target, we are in a much stronger position as we enter 2025."
Shares rose 1.13p to 7.38p.
